How to Pronounce Colossal

To pronounce "colossal", say col-OSS-al — 3 syllables, IPA /kəˈɫɑsəɫ/. Tap play below to hear it in four English accents, or practice it syllable by syllable.

What does colossal mean?

adjective

  1. Extremely large or on a great scale.

    A single puppy can make a colossal mess.
